How to Restore Missing Arrows from Desktop Shortcut Icons

My Windows 11 desktop has shortcut icons, the little arrows of which have all disappeared. Shortcut icons appearing elsewhere (other than the desktop) display correctly, with the arrow identifying them as shortcuts. I want to restore the desktop shortcut icons so that they appear correctly, with the small arrow identifying them as shortcuts, as opposed to files or folders. How can I do this? Thanks!

  • Check Registry for Shortcut Arrow Settings

    1. Open Registry Editor:
      • Press Win + R, type regedit, and hit Enter.
    2. Navigate to this key:H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Shell Icons
    3. Look for a value named 29:
      • If it exists and points to an empty icon file (often used to remove arrows), delete the 29 value.
    4. Restart your PC.
